TomatoTimer

A time management tool will ensure that you get to work and do not squander your necessary time on pointless activities if, like most of us, you suffer from the procrastination jinx.

TomatoTimer is a program for managing your time. The program uses the Pomodoro technique, which sets a timer for 25 minutes and requires that you give your work your full attention for the entire interval before taking a brief break and repeating that task.

Anki

You may have heard of flashcards. They are a fantastic tool for quickly processing enormous amounts of information and ensuring that you do not forget it easily.

However, the drawback with conventional paper flashcards is that you risk losing the knowledge you value most if you lose them. This is why you need Anki, which offers a digital solution to all these issues with traditional flashcards, allowing you to effortlessly preserve your information and access a big database with more content than conventional paper flashcards.

Zotero

Zotero is a different instructional tool that will be very helpful to you as you continue your academic career. The program makes it easier for you to work on your thesis or research paper because it maintains track of all the sources and citations you use.

The program also allows you to use multiple sources for your documents; Zotero will keep track of them all and prevent you from being caught off guard.
